Nigeria on Tuesday recorded three more deaths and 505 new cases of COVID-19.
This was disclosed by the Nigeria Centre for Disease Control (NCDC) in an update on its website, on Tuesday night.
The agency noted that the latest statistics were drawn across 15 states of the federation and the Federal Capital Territory, FCT.
“On the 3rd of August 2021, 505 new confirmed cases and 3 deaths were recorded in Nigeria
“The 505 new cases are reported from 13 states-Lagos (275), Rivers (63), Akwa Ibom (62), Gombe (22), Ogun (8), FCT (4), Edo (3), Imo (2), Kano (1), Nasarawa(1), Sokoto (1), Jigawa (1), Ebonyi (1),” NCDC said.
With the latest statistics, the NCDC said the total number of confirmed cases in the country has risen to 175,264.
